Our Thriving Community Social Sustainability Strategy was adopted by the Township of Langley Council in 2022 to put the Township on course for a connected, inclusive, and resilient community. Coro collaborated with Solstice Sustainability Works and Modus Planning, Design and Engagement to develop Our Thriving Community Social Sustainability Strategy for the Township of Langley.

Our Thriving Community Social Sustainability Strategy establishes a clear vision for the Township’s future — a connected, inclusive, and resilient community where everyone can enjoy and contribute to a great quality of life — and sets a course to get there. While many people in the Township currently enjoy a great quality of life, not everyone is thriving. Rapid population growth, climate change, technological advancement, and unexpected events like the COVID-19 pandemic necessitate a strategy to guide the Township toward its vision. Our Thriving Community Social Sustainability Strategy identifies three goals and six priority areas with actions to pursue in partnership with other organizations and groups.

Goals include:

  • Connected Community
  • Inclusive Community
  • Resilient Community

The six priorities include:

  • Indigenous Relations
  • Belonging
  • Housing and Food
  • Learning
  • Getting Around
  • Health and Safety

By working more collaboratively, thinking big, and being open to doing things differently, the Township hopes to realize its social sustainability vision.
